Specic Absorption Rate
(SAR) Safety
This device has been designed to comply
with applicable safety requirements
for exposure to radio waves. These
requirements are designed for the safety of
all persons and follow scientific guidelines
including safety margins.
The radio wave exposure guidelines
employ a unit of measurement known
as the Specific Absorption Rate or
SAR. Tests for SAR are conducted
using standardised methods, with
the device transmitting at its highest
certified power level in all used
frequency bands.
This device is designed and
manufactured not to exceed emission
limits for radio frequency (RF) energy
exposure.
